Account Updater 101

If your company’s lifeline is recurring revenue, preventing customer churn is crucial to success. Subscription businesses stay afloat by maintaining a high uptime, reaching out to disengaged users and leveraging their current customer base for highly qualified referrals.

Until recently, it’s been nearly impossible to minimize the loss of revenue associated with outdated payment information. Account UpdaterAccount Updater Account Updater (VAU) is a service that facilitates and encourages customer satisfaction, retention and loyalty by exchanging updated account information between participating merchants and Visa / Mastercard or other card issuers. MasterCard calls it Automatic Billing Updater (ABU) while Visa terms it Visa Account Updater (VAU), a service which provides companies that rely on recurring billing with up-to-date financial information on customers, can ensure that your revenue stream remains as stable as possible.

Why Account Updater Matters

While very little data is available on how often a typical customer will update their billing address or credit card information, experts estimate that subscription businesses can expect to lose up to 5-10% of their business annually.

It’s not a matter of customer dissatisfaction or disengagement, but simply being unable to continue recurring billing on clients who haven’t updated their payment information. Manual follow-ups to receive accurate information from customers can be successful, but outreach can be costly for a SaaS company, especially if multiple attempts are required to make contact.

Benefits of the Program

Repeated declined payments can have a significant negative impact on SaaS companies. Manually updating payment information requires an enormous time investment from sales or customer service representatives. Finally, customers also benefit from having a positive payment experience with their SaaS subscriptions. There’s no disruption in their service and no need for them to reach out with updated information.

For subscription businesses and other companies that rely on recurring billing as a source for revenue, Account Updater is undoubtedly a positive change. Your monthly churn due to outdated payment information will be minimized.
